Christmas Eve is not just about food and gifts. It is also about how your home feels when everyone sits together at the table. A well-decorated Christmas table makes the dinner more special and welcoming. While decorating, people should always keep a few things in mind. Choose a colour theme, avoid overcrowding the table, keep space for food, use soft lighting, and make sure everything matches the Christmas mood.

| Style | How People Used It | Popular Materials & Finishes | Best Placement on the Table | What People Loved About It |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Table Linen | Used as tablecloths, runners, and placemats | Cotton, linen, blended fabrics | Spread across the full table or layered with runners | Made the table look neat and well-planned |
| Candle Holder | Used for dinner mood lighting | Glass, metal, ceramic | Centre or sides of the table | Created a warm and calm atmosphere |
| Glassware | Used for water, wine, and mocktails | Clear glass, tinted glass | Near place settings | Added shine and reflected light beautifully |
| Showpiece | Used as statement table accents | Resin, wood, metal | Centre of the table | Gave character and festive identity |
| Floral Arrangement | Used as fresh or artificial centrepieces | Fresh flowers, faux florals | Middle of the table | Made the setup feel fresh and welcoming |
In 2025, table linen became a big trend because people wanted their Christmas tables to look neat and warm, as it helps you get a luxury look to the table without putting much time on it. People liked using linen with simple textures instead of heavy prints, as it gave a clean and calm base for other decorations.
Candle holders were a top choice in 2025 because candles add warm light and a holiday feeling to the Christmas table. People choose stylish yet simple holders made of glass, metal, or wood. These candle holders were trending because they worked with many decor styles.
Glassware became popular because it made even simple meals look special. People liked mixing different glass pieces to add a fun, personalised touch to the table. Glassware also reflected light from candles and Christmas lights, which lifted the mood.
Showpieces like small figurines, reindeer sculptures, or Christmas-themed objects ruled in 2025 because they gave focus to the table centre. These items helped define the style of the table, whether it was classic, minimal, or modern. People liked showpieces that told a simple story or brought memories of past holidays.
Floral arrangements were one of the most loved trends in 2025. Fresh flowers, greenery, and seasonal blooms added natural colour and life to the Christmas table. This trend stayed popular because flowers made every table look cheerful and inviting, and many guests appreciated the natural beauty they brought to celebrations.

1. Why is Christmas table decoration important?
It sets the mood and makes the dinner feel special and festive. It brings the family and closed ones together at the dining table to celebrate the holiday season and ending the year with the last festival
2. What colours work best for a Christmas table?
Red, green, white, gold, and silver are common and easy to use. You can even use bnold colours depending on the theme you are throwing
3. Should I decorate the table before cooking?
Basic decor can be done before, but final setup is best after cooking.
4. How can I decorate a small table?
Use fewer items, small candles, and a simple centrepiece. You can decorate the table with a simple table linen
5. Are candles safe for table decor?
Yes, if placed away from napkins and used carefully. Try to keep clothes decor essentials away from it.
